Question :
What is texture mapping? Explain how to do texture mapping in a surface / model?
Answer :
Texture mapping is mapping of any image into multidimensional space
To do texture mapping in a model :
Define the 2D coordinate (s, t) in the image (usually the value is normalized to [0, 1])
Assign or map the texture coordinate to each vertices in 3D surface
After each vertices is mapped into texture value, change the pixel value (RGB) in the surface model accordingly

Question :
What is aliasing?Explain why aliasing / artifact can present in the texture mapping process?
Answer :
Aliasing is incorrect rendering of a scene because a model is masquerading as one of many other models who sample identically. It is appear as jagged line
Aliasing occurred because an on-screen pixel does not always map neatly to a texel. This will cause jagged edges

Question :
What is mipmapping? How can mipmapping reduce aliasing?
Answer :
Mipmapping is pre-calculation on how the texture should look at various distances, then use the appropriate texture at each distance
Mipmapping can reduce aliasing because for every level of depth, it uses the appropriate pre-calculated texture
